Common Skin Problems That Require a Dermatologist
Persistent Acne and Severe Breakouts
Acne is a widespread skin condition affecting individuals of all ages. While mild cases may respond to basic skincare, persistent or severe acne often needs specialized treatment to prevent scarring and improve skin appearance. A dermatologist can prescribe potent medications, recommend suitable skincare regimens, and explore advanced therapies like laser treatments.
Unexplained Skin Rashes and Irritations
Skin rashes that do not resolve within a few days or keep recurring should be evaluated by a dermatologist. Persistent rashes may indicate underlying allergies, infections, or chronic conditions that require precise diagnosis and targeted treatment.
Changes in Skin Color or Size of Moles
Any new, changing, or irregular moles should prompt a consultation with a dermatologist. Monitoring and evaluation are critical for early detection of skin cancers, which significantly improves treatment outcomes.
Persistent Itching and Discomfort
Chronic itching or discomfort may be symptoms of underlying skin conditions such as eczema or psoriasis. Professional assessment helps identify the root cause and develop an effective treatment strategy.
Hair and Nail Disorders
Problems like hair loss, scalp conditions, or nail infections can impact overall health and appearance. A dermatologist’s expertise ensures appropriate management and treatment of these issues.
When to Seek Immediate Dermatological Attention
Sudden Skin Changes or Severe Symptoms
Rapidly spreading rashes, blistering, or severe pain indicate urgent medical attention. Immediate consultation with a dermatologist is necessary to prevent complications and alleviate discomfort.
Signs of Skin Infection
Signs such as swelling, pus, or warmth around a skin lesion suggest infection, requiring prompt professional care for proper management.

The Importance of Preventive Skin Care
Daily Skincare Routine
Adopting a suitable daily skincare routine tailored to your skin type helps prevent many common skin issues. This includes cleansing, moisturizing, sun protection, and avoiding harsh products.
Sun Protection
Consistent use of sunscreens and protective clothing shields skin from harmful UV rays, reducing the risk of sun damage, premature aging, and skin cancers.
Lifestyle Factors
A balanced diet, adequate hydration, stress management, and avoiding smoking and excessive alcohol consumption contribute to healthier skin.

FAQs
Q1: When should I see a dermatologist for my skin problem?
You should consider consulting a dermatologist if your skin issue persists for more than a couple of weeks, worsens over time, or is accompanied by pain, bleeding, or other concerning symptoms.
Q2: Can a dermatologist help with cosmetic skin concerns?
Yes, dermatologists are trained to perform cosmetic procedures such as Botox, fillers, chemical peels, and laser treatments, helping improve skin appearance and boost confidence.
Q3: Are dermatologists qualified to treat hair and nail conditions?
Absolutely. Dermatologists have specialized training to diagnose and treat various hair and nail disorders effectively.
Q4: How often should I visit a dermatologist for skin check-ups?
Routine skin check-ups are recommended annually for maintaining skin health, but those with higher risk factors or skin conditions should follow their dermatologist’s advice for more frequent visits.
